Jiuting ({{zh|c=九亭|p=Jiǔtíng}}) is a station on Shanghai Metro Line 9.{{Cite web|title=Jiuting {{!}} ExploreShanghai|url=https://exploreshanghai.com/metro/pedia/station/jiuting/|access-date=2020-12-15|website=exploreshanghai.com}} It began operation on December 29, 2007. It is located in Jiuting Town of Songjiang District. Upon exiting the station through the south exit, there are a variety of small shops and restaurants in a mini-mall format, including McDonald's and KFC.

North Huting Road is the primary North-South street immediately adjacent to the station. Traveling South will take you into old Jiuting downtown. Traveling North will take you into a newer area with shops, apartment housing and restaurants.

Jiuting is approximately 15 minutes by taxi from Shanghai Hongqiao International Airport.
